Washington Regional Association of Grantmakers: A Leading Philanthropy Association in Washington, D.C.
The Washington Regional Association of Grantmakers is a prominent non-profit organization located at 1100 New Jersey Ave SE, Washington, DC 20003. This organization specializes in connecting grantmakers and community organizations to facilitate effective philanthropy in the Washington D.C. region.
